Not available - typically a solitary experience.<br><br>Cognitive Biases <br><br>The Gambler's Fallacy: The mistaken belief that if something happens more frequently than normal during a given period, it will happen less frequently in the future (e.g., "Red has come up 5 times in a row, so black is due"). Loss Aversion: The pain of losing is psychologically about twice as powerful as the pleasure of gaining. Near Misses: When the outcome is close to a jackpot (e.g., two out of three symbols line up), the brain reacts similarly to a wincasino ([https://gst.meu.edu.jo/employer/mocnimiloscia/ https://gst.meu.edu.jo/employer/mocnimiloscia/]) encouraging more play. Not knowing when the next win will come keeps players engaged far longer than a predictable reward schedule would. This can lead to "chasing losses" in an attempt to get back to even. Wheel Variations <br><br>European Roulette: Features numbers 1-36 and a single zero (0). Let's look at the probabilities and payouts for common bets on a European wheel. For this reason, savvy players always prefer European or French Roulette when available. American Roulette: Features numbers 1-36, a single zero (0), and a double zero (00). The extra pocket nearly doubles the house edge to 5.26%. French Roulette: Similar to European Roulette, but includes rules like "La Partage" or "En Prison" that can reduce the house edge on even-money bets to as low as 1.35%.<br><br>Your Well-being Matters <br>Gambling should always be a form of entertainment, not a way to make money.
